- HOME EXPERIENCE
Uncover the presence of Ozhin within your home and prepare yourself for an eerie encounter as supernatural occurrences come to life. This feature uses Google Home to interact with your home devices and deliver an immersive horror experience. Ozhin will make its presence felt through rapid and random flashing of lights, creating an unsettling atmosphere that will heighten the tension. This feature is only available to users with Google Home accessories.
Important Warning:
This experience includes flashing lights which may not be suitable for individuals with epilepsy or those sensitive to intense light patterns. If you have epilepsy, are prone to seizures, or have sensitivity to flashing lights, please exercise caution or refrain from using this feature to avoid any potential risks.

What is an XAPK file, and what should I do if the Countdown App I downloaded is an XAPK file?
Open up
A file with .xapk extension is a compressed package file. It is a container file format that incorporates APK and additional associated files required for the installation.
The XAPK format was introduced to package the APK file and OBB file together for a seamless delivery and installation process.
XAPK format can help reduce the package size of application.
